Precarious peace on first anniversary of war
On August 7 2008, Georgia and Russia went to war over the small breakaway province of South Ossetia. One year on, tensions on the ground remain high, to the point that there are even fears in some quarters of another war.
Cyril Vanier, FRANCE 24's international correspondent in Tbilisi, and Robert Parsons, FRANCE 24's international affairs editor, who was in Georgia during the war last year, analyse the situation on the ground.
